About the Position: As a Delivery Driver, you will play a vital role in ensuring that kids receive the meals they need, delivered with care and a smile. This role is perfect for someone who enjoys interacting with children, takes pride in being reliable, and thrives in a customer-focused, energetic environment. What You'll Do:
- Deliver joy Bring fresh, healthy lunches to schools and ensure a smooth handoff to students and staff.
- Be the friendly face Provide excellent customer service and create a positive lunchtime experience.
- Stay organized & accountable Manage daily meal service and deliveries with efficiency and professionalism, ensuring meals are distributed in a timely manner and lunchers are assisted during the check out process.
- Uphold our values Show up with a positive attitude, communicate with transparency, and take ownership of your role.
- A reliable, punctual, and professional individual who enjoys working with children
- A strong communicator who can interact with school staff, parents, and students with ease
- A friendly, outgoing, and service-oriented personality that creates a welcoming environment
- Availability for 2-4 hours per day (typically between 9:30 AM - 1:30 PM), Monday through Friday
- Strong time management and verbal communication skills
- A smartphone for job-related communication
- A reliable personal vehicle with valid proof of insurance
- ServSafe Food Handler Certification (or willingness to obtain within first 14 days of employment)
- Ability to clear a pre-employment background check and earn additional certifications if required by the school
